Product Review: BEWARE! 12g sugar and 80 calories a day to get your stanols! Summary: 2 StarsI bought these because it seemed a compelling way to get plant stanols, which medical literature praise for their cholesterol reducing abilities. I don't consume a lot of bread, so the benecol/stanol butter substitute spreads were not a reliable source of stanols for me.
However, these chews aren't all they are cracked up to be. If you have 4 chews per day (like they suggest), you get 16 grams of carbs, 12 grams of sugar, and 80 calories! For anyone who has high cholesterol + high triglycerides, that isn't a desirable way to get your stanols. Even if these lower your cholesterol, the offsetting risk to your triglycerides might negate the heart healthy benefits. I'm no expert on this, but I find that eating too many sugars only makes me hungrier.
If you like to have spreads on your breads and are using stanols as part of your heart health regimen, I'd suggest a tub of Benecol or Smart Balance instead!
Benecol - can you bring me stanols in a capsule without the sugar?
